Athlone Town trio selected for UEFA U19 women's qualifiers

Three Athlone Town players have been selected in the Republic of Ireland Under 19 squad for the upcoming UEFA women's round two qualifiers in April.

Defender Lucy Fitzgerald, midfield player Emma Mooney and striker Hazel Donegan will all be hoping to get some minutes in the green jersey during fixtures against Germany, France and Slovakia.

Mooney featured for the Republic of Ireland women’s U17 team in their recent UEFA EURO qualifiers in Sweden, her form during these set of fixtures earning the midfielder a call up to the U19 squad.

In order to reach the finals tournament in Bosnia & Herzegovina, the Republic of Ireland will have to come out of a difficult group.

The Republic of Ireland start their round two qualifying phase with a fixture against Germany in Essen on Friday, April 10.

Essen is also the venue for their second qualifier against France on Monday, April 13, before they conclude this phase of fixtures with a game against Slovakia in Velbert on Thursday, April 16.
